Understanding Bread Machine Capacity and Dimensions
Bread machine size isn’t just about the physical dimensions of the appliance. It also encompasses the capacity, which refers to the size of the loaf the machine can bake. These two factors – physical size and capacity – are intertwined but distinct considerations.
Physical Dimensions: Making Space in Your Kitchen
The physical dimensions of a bread machine determine how much counter or storage space it will occupy. Bread machines come in a range of sizes, from compact models designed for small kitchens to larger machines with additional features and capacity.
A smaller bread machine might measure around 10 inches wide, 12 inches deep, and 12 inches tall. These models are ideal for individuals or small families with limited counter space. On the other end of the spectrum, larger bread machines can be 13 inches wide, 15 inches deep, and 14 inches tall or even larger. These are generally designed for baking larger loaves or offering additional features like multiple loaf sizes or specialized programs.
Before purchasing a bread machine, it’s essential to measure your available counter space and consider where you’ll store the machine when it’s not in use. Remember to account for adequate ventilation around the machine during operation, as it will release heat.
Capacity: Loaf Size Matters
The capacity of a bread machine refers to the size of the loaf it can bake, typically measured in pounds. Common loaf sizes include 1-pound, 1.5-pound, 2-pound, and even 2.5-pound loaves.
- 1-Pound Loaf: Suitable for individuals or very small households. These machines are usually more compact.
- 1.5-Pound Loaf: A good option for small families or those who don’t consume a lot of bread.
- 2-Pound Loaf: The most common size and a versatile choice for most families.
- 2.5-Pound Loaf: Ideal for larger families or those who frequently bake bread for gatherings.
Choosing the right capacity depends on your bread consumption habits. If you regularly bake bread for a large family, a machine with a larger capacity is essential. Conversely, if you only bake occasionally or live alone, a smaller capacity machine will suffice.

Loaf Capacity and Machine Size: A Direct Correlation
As previously mentioned, there’s a direct relationship between loaf capacity and machine size. A bread machine designed to bake larger loaves will naturally be larger than a machine designed for smaller loaves. This is because the baking pan, kneading paddle, and heating element all need to be appropriately sized to accommodate the larger loaf.

The Importance of Proper Ventilation
Regardless of the size of the bread machine you choose, it’s crucial to ensure proper ventilation during operation. Bread machines generate heat while baking, and inadequate ventilation can lead to overheating, which can damage the machine or even pose a safety hazard.
Make sure to place the bread machine on a stable, heat-resistant surface with adequate clearance around it. Avoid placing the machine directly under cabinets or near flammable materials. Follow the manufacturer’s instructions regarding ventilation requirements.

What are the Common Dimensions of a Standard Bread Machine?
While there’s no single “standard” size, most bread machines fall within a certain range. A typical machine capable of baking a 1.5 to 2-pound loaf might measure roughly 12 to 14 inches in height, 10 to 12 inches in width, and 14 to 16 inches in depth. These measurements offer a general guideline, but it’s vital to consult the specific product specifications before purchasing.
Keep in mind that these are external dimensions. The interior dimensions of the bread pan itself are equally important, especially if you plan on adapting recipes from other sources. Pay attention to the pan’s capacity and shape to ensure compatibility with your baking needs. Larger machines will typically have larger internal pan dimensions as well.

Do the Internal Dimensions of the Bread Pan Vary Between Different Bread Machines?
Yes, the internal dimensions of the bread pan can vary significantly between different bread machines, even those with the same loaf capacity rating. Different manufacturers often employ different pan shapes and sizes to optimize baking performance or achieve a specific loaf shape. This is especially noticeable when comparing pans from different brands or different models within the same brand.
This variation is crucial to consider if you plan to adapt recipes or use bread mixes designed for specific pan sizes. A recipe formulated for a rectangular pan might not bake properly in a more square or oval-shaped pan. Always verify the pan dimensions and capacity before adapting recipes to ensure a successful outcome.
